
java如何与sql连接数据库
用户关注问题
Java中连接SQL数据库需要哪些驱动?
为了在Java程序中成功连接SQL数据库,需要使用哪些类型的数据库驱动?
使用JDBC驱动连接数据库
Java连接SQL数据库通常采用JDBC(Java Database Connectivity)驱动。具体选择哪种驱动取决于所使用的数据库类型,比如MySQL使用mysql-connector-java,SQL Server使用mssql-jdbc。确保将相应的驱动包添加到项目的classpath中,才能实现正常连接。
Java代码如何配置数据库连接的URL和参数?
在Java程序中设置数据库连接时,数据库URL和参数应该如何编写?
格式化数据库连接URL
数据库连接URL的格式依赖于具体数据库类型。以MySQL为例,格式通常为jdbc:mysql://hostname:port/databasename,其中hostname为数据库服务器地址,port为端口号,databasename为具体数据库名称。连接URL中可以加入参数以配置字符编码、时区等选项,确保数据传输和解析正确。
如何使用Java执行SQL查询并处理结果集?
连接数据库后,怎样在Java中执行SQL语句并有效处理查询结果?
利用Statement和ResultSet处理数据
通过Java中的Statement或PreparedStatement对象可以执行SQL查询语句,执行查询后返回一个ResultSet对象,程序可遍历ResultSet获取数据。使用while循环配合ResultSet的next()方法遍历行,并调用相应的getXxx方法读取列值。最后记得关闭ResultSet和Statement释放资源。